Use "guess and check" on a calculator to determine the solution(s) to the following equations. a) (n/2)=105 b) nC3=84 c) 11Cn=330 Please explain, thanks!

11Cn is the simplest, since its something int the row, its not 11C0 11C1 11C11 or 11C10 the others are about finding the other part .... a 'halfway' trial is the quickest guessing method n C 3 = 84 ; n is not 84 but its a trial, 84C3 is bigger than 84, so half it try 42 42C3 = 11480 this is only going to take at best 7 tries ... to big, half it 21C3 = 1330, half it again 10C3 = 120, half it again 5C3 = 10 so its either 6,7,8,9 try 7 7C3 = 35 8C3 = 56 9C3 = 84
